Mohamed Salah Becomes Liverpool's All-Time Top Scorer in Europe

The Egyptian forward marks a significant milestone with his 50th goal for Liverpool in European competitions.
Since joining Liverpool in 2017, Mohamed Salah has established himself as a pivotal figure in European football, garnering widespread acclaim for his performance on the field.

On October 25, 2023, Salah reached a remarkable milestone, scoring his 50th goal for Liverpool in European competitions, achieving this feat in just 83 matches.

This accomplishment positions him as the all-time leading scorer for the club in UEFA tournaments.
